Oracle数据库数据恢复、性能优化

找回密码
注册
搜索
热搜: 活动 交友 discuz
发新帖

316

积分

0

好友

0

主题
1#
发表于 2012-3-7 16:27:11 | 查看: 10115| 回复: 6
升级的时候没有仔细检查,结果,ASM PFILE里只有DATA,没有FRA,所以升级后只有一个ora.DATA.dg的资源。
现在PFILE已修改,FRA DG 已 MOUNT。

不会仅此而已吧?
crsctl add resource ora.FRA.dg -type ora.diskgroup.type
2#
发表于 2012-3-7 18:36:56
答案:
crsctl stat res ora.DATA.dg -p > ora.DATA.dg
vim ora.DATA.dg

cat ora.DATA.dg

NAME=ora.FRA.dg     //修改这里
TYPE=ora.diskgroup.type
ACL=owner:oracle:rwx,pgrp:oinstall:rwx,other::r--
ACTION_FAILURE_TEMPLATE=
ACTION_SCRIPT=
AGENT_FILENAME=%CRS_HOME%/bin/oraagent%CRS_EXE_SUFFIX%
ALIAS_NAME=
AUTO_START=never
CHECK_INTERVAL=300
CHECK_TIMEOUT=30
DEFAULT_TEMPLATE=
DEGREE=1
DESCRIPTION=CRS resource type definition for ASM disk group resource
ENABLED=1
LOAD=1
LOGGING_LEVEL=1
NLS_LANG=
NOT_RESTARTING_TEMPLATE=
OFFLINE_CHECK_INTERVAL=0
PROFILE_CHANGE_TEMPLATE=
RESTART_ATTEMPTS=5
SCRIPT_TIMEOUT=60
START_DEPENDENCIES=hard(ora.asm) pullup(ora.asm)
START_TIMEOUT=900
STATE_CHANGE_TEMPLATE=
STOP_DEPENDENCIES=hard(intermediate:ora.asm)
STOP_TIMEOUT=180
TYPE_VERSION=1.2
UPTIME_THRESHOLD=1d
USR_ORA_ENV=
USR_ORA_OPI=false
USR_ORA_STOP_MODE=
VERSION=11.2.0.3.0

crsctl add res ora.FRA.dg -type ora.diskgroup.type -file ora.DATA.dg

crsctl start res ora.FRA.dg

crsctl stat res ora.FRA.dg
NAME=ora.FRA.dg
TYPE=ora.diskgroup.type
TARGET=ONLINE          , ONLINE
STATE=ONLINE on node01, ONLINE on node02

回复 只看该作者 道具 举报

3#
发表于 2012-3-7 20:35:04
自问自答?  Great Post

回复 只看该作者 道具 举报

4#
发表于 2012-3-11 22:42:35
但是为什么这个地方的  AUTO_START=never  呢?

回复 只看该作者 道具 举报

5#
发表于 2012-3-11 23:17:24
[root@vrh2 ~]# cat /etc/oracle/ocr.loc
ocrconfig_loc=+systemdg
local_only=FALSE

The OCR diskgroup is auto mounted by the ASM instance during startup. The CRSD and ASM
dependency is maintained by OHASD.

ASM has to be up with the diskgroup mounted before any OCR operations can be
performed. There are bugs reported when the diskgroup having OCR was dismounted force
and/or ASM instance was shutdown abort.
When the stack is running, CRSD keeps reading/writing OCR.
OHASD maintains the resource dependency and will bring up ASM with the required
diskgroup mounted before it starts CRSD.

回复 只看该作者 道具 举报

6#
发表于 2012-3-11 23:19:04
NON-OCR/Votedisk

[root@vrh2 ~]# crsctl stat res ora.DATA.dg -p
NAME=ora.DATA.dg
TYPE=ora.diskgroup.type
ACL=owner:grid:rwx,pgrp:oinstall:rwx,other::r--
ACTION_FAILURE_TEMPLATE=
ACTION_SCRIPT=
AGENT_FILENAME=%CRS_HOME%/bin/oraagent%CRS_EXE_SUFFIX%
ALIAS_NAME=
AUTO_START=always
CHECK_INTERVAL=300
CHECK_TIMEOUT=30
DEFAULT_TEMPLATE=
DEGREE=1
DESCRIPTION=CRS resource type definition for ASM disk group resource
ENABLED=1
LOAD=1
LOGGING_LEVEL=1
NLS_LANG=
NOT_RESTARTING_TEMPLATE=
OFFLINE_CHECK_INTERVAL=0
PROFILE_CHANGE_TEMPLATE=
RESTART_ATTEMPTS=5
SCRIPT_TIMEOUT=60
START_DEPENDENCIES=hard(ora.asm) pullup(ora.asm)
START_TIMEOUT=900
STATE_CHANGE_TEMPLATE=
STOP_DEPENDENCIES=hard(intermediate:ora.asm)
STOP_TIMEOUT=180
TYPE_VERSION=1.2
UPTIME_THRESHOLD=1d
USR_ORA_ENV=
USR_ORA_OPI=false
USR_ORA_STOP_MODE=
VERSION=11.2.0.3.0

回复 只看该作者 道具 举报

7#
发表于 2012-3-12 09:04:29
AUTO_START

Indicates whether Oracle Clusterware automatically starts a resource after a cluster server restart. Valid AUTO_START values are:

    always: Restarts the resource when the server restarts regardless of the state of the resource when the server stopped.

    restore: Restores the resource to the same state that it was in when the server stopped. Oracle Clusterware attempts to restart the resource if the value of TARGET was ONLINE before the server stopped.

    never: Oracle Clusterware never restarts the resource regardless of the state of the resource when the server stopped.

回复 只看该作者 道具 举报

您需要登录后才可以回帖 登录 | 注册

QQ|手机版|Archiver|Oracle数据库数据恢复、性能优化

GMT+8, 2024-11-15 10:12 , Processed in 0.055965 second(s), 21 queries .

Powered by Discuz! X2.5

© 2001-2012 Comsenz Inc.

回顶部
TEL/電話+86 13764045638
Email service@parnassusdata.com
QQ 47079569